This is the latest example of how horribly thought out Microsoft's spam
solution is:

A customer of ours has a website which someone signed up to (created an
account). The website sent a confirmation email to that person, and for
certain reasons, it bounced back. Our customer, who is using a Hotmail
address, then *marked the bounceback email as Junk*, affecting our IP
rating according to SNDS.

How does that make any sense? Why should our reputation be affected because
this customer won't dispose of the message properly and just marks it as
Junk to get rid of it?

How are other people dealing with issues like this?
